Abstract

A method of manufacturing a hot press formed part by hot pressing a coated steel sheet that is obtained by forming a Zn-based coating layer on a surface of a steel sheet includes: heating the coated steel sheet to a temperature range of 750° C. or more and 1000° C. or less; cooling a surface of the coated steel sheet; and hot press forming the coated steel sheet under a condition that a surface temperature of the coated steel sheet is 400° C. or less and an average temperature of the coated steel sheet is 500° C. or more or a temperature of a center position of the coated steel sheet in a thickness direction is 530° C. or more.
